# Basement Archive Room — Night Access

The archive room under Pellworth House holds old contracts and the tape backups. Night shift: take stairwell C, not the lift (it's switched off after midnight). Lights are on a timer by the door — slap the button as you go in. Sign the logbook, even at 3am, yes really. The keypad by the door takes the code below.

staff pass of fahap-tajeg = bdg-FT-6

Welcome to Marlowe & Tey. Please note that the reception desk has moved from Level 3 to the ground floor lobby, opposite the Caldo Café counter. All new starters should check in there between 08:30 and 10:00 on their first day. To collect your welcome pack, present the door-pass code below at the desk.

badge for fafop-fajof: bdg-Z-47

Handover for the Copperwren firmware update channel: the staging ring is paused after a rollback on gateway units running build 4.7. Root cause is a signature cache mismatch; fix is in review under the delta-verifier branch. Please prioritize that review so we can resume canary rollout Thursday. If you need context on the signing pipeline, contact the release steward.

escalation mailbox, bafog-fafog: ulador@paliqlabs.internal

**Vendor note: Inkmill markdown pipeline**

Rendering for Parchway docs is outsourced to Inkmill under an annual contract, renewing each March. They handle sanitization and PDF export; we own the upload queue. SLA: 4-hour response on rendering failures. Escalate only after two failed retries. Their support desk is reachable at the address below.

billing contact of hahaf-baguf = zorael.tammir.jorius@sivrelhq.internal

**What does the Mailrake bounce processor do with message content?**

Nothing is stored. Headers are parsed for bounce classification, then discarded; bodies are never read. Only the recipient hash and bounce code persist, retained ninety days. Processing runs inside the sealed Corvane subnet. The data-flow diagram sits on the page below.

dashboard of bafof-hafog = https://confluence.lumiclabs.internal/display/browse/display/6a09a20a